Artist's Response. Co-author of controversial children's book speaks out: "The uproar over an elementary school library book in Wilmington is now international..." There have been complaints in America about the picture book King and King by Linda De Haan and Stern Nijland. In this article, the illustrator responds. [ACHOCKABLOG]
I've read this book, and it is cute and funny, but America is just not ready for this sort of thing yet. I was curious about a quote in another article from the parents who started the outcry: "My child is not old enough to understand something like that, especially when it's not in our beliefs," Mr. Hartsell said. Oh, dear, there's so much I could say about children's books and beliefs, but I'd just be adding to the noise. I just think this whole controversy is sad.

Update 3/27/04: Here's a follow-up article. I guess the parents won, but, really, everyone loses.
